Transaction 4768530cae7c0691428552f151af64587fdf8eef8d8ea4d4e0367bfbbed9e23f
1 Input
1 Output
-
4768530cae7c0691428552f151af64587fdf8eef8d8ea4d4e0367bfbbed9e23f:0
- value
- 1999900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c986ba3187b207592f34d8ea7eadb5f6d67cf8b OP_EQUAL
- address
- 3MoRB757UJrfWfU8Ydxv2giqSY1F3ViB3L